引言
在网页设计中,轮播图(Carousel)是一种常见的交互元素,它能够有效地展示多张图片或内容。jQuery Carousel 提供了一种简单而强大的方式来创建动态的轮播效果。本文将深入探讨如何使用 jQuery Carousel 来打造炫酷的轮播效果。
一、什么是jQuery Carousel?
jQuery Carousel 是一个基于 jQuery 的插件,它允许你轻松地创建响应式和交互式的轮播图。这个插件支持多种配置选项,包括自动播放、指示器、导航按钮等。
二、准备工作
在开始使用 jQuery Carousel 之前,你需要确保以下几点:
- 引入jQuery库:在你的HTML文件中引入jQuery库。
- 引入Carousel插件:可以从 jQuery Carousel 官网 下载插件,并将其引入到你的项目中。
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
<script src="path/to/owl.carousel.min.js"></script>
三、基本使用
以下是使用 jQuery Carousel 创建基本轮播图的步骤:
- HTML结构:创建一个包含图片或内容的容器,并为每个项目添加一个类名。
- CSS样式:为轮播图添加一些基本的样式。
- 初始化Carousel:使用jQuery选择器初始化Carousel。
<div id="carousel" class="owl-carousel">
<div class="item"><img src="image1.jpg" alt="Image 1"></div>
<div class="item"><img src="image2.jpg" alt="Image 2"></div>
<div class="item"><img src="image3.jpg" alt="Image 3"></div>
</div>
#carousel .item {
width: 100%;
display: block;
}
$(document).ready(function(){
$("#carousel").owlCarousel();
});
四、高级配置
jQuery Carousel 提供了丰富的配置选项,以下是一些常用的配置:
- 自动播放:设置
autoPlay
选项来启用自动播放。 - 导航按钮:使用
nav
选项来添加左右导航按钮。 - 指示器:使用
dots
选项来添加底部指示器。
$("#carousel").owlCarousel({
autoPlay: true,
navigation: true,
dots: true
});
五、响应式设计
jQuery Carousel 是响应式的,它会根据屏幕大小自动调整轮播图的布局。你可以使用 responsive
选项来进一步自定义不同屏幕尺寸下的轮播图行为。
$("#carousel").owlCarousel({
responsive: {
0: {
items: 1
},
600: {
items: 2
},
1000: {
items: 3
}
}
});
六、总结
通过使用 jQuery Carousel,你可以轻松地创建出炫酷的轮播效果。本文介绍了如何从基本使用到高级配置,以及如何实现响应式设计。希望这篇文章能够帮助你打造出满意的轮播图效果。